Understanding Your Gas Stove’s Electrical System

Before you dive into a repair, it helps to understand the basics of what makes your gas stove tick electrically. Gas stoves use electricity primarily for two things: igniting the gas and sometimes powering control boards or clocks.

The most common electrical components you’ll encounter are the igniters, which create a spark to light the gas burners, and the wiring that connects these igniters to the control module.

Common Problems with Gas Stove Wiring

Wires, like any other component, can degrade over time. Understanding common problems with how to change wire in gas stove will help you diagnose the issue.

  • Wear and Tear: Constant heat exposure, especially near burners, can degrade wire insulation, leading to shorts or breaks.
  • Corrosion: Spills and moisture can cause corrosion on wire terminals, interrupting electrical flow.
  • Physical Damage: Wires can get pinched, cut, or chewed by pests, leading to complete circuit breaks.
  • Loose Connections: Vibrations or age can loosen connections, causing intermittent problems.

When an igniter isn’t sparking, or only sparks intermittently, a faulty wire is a prime suspect. Replacing it can often resolve the issue, saving you significant repair costs.

Safety First: Essential Precautions Before You Begin

Working with gas appliances and electricity demands the utmost respect for safety. This isn’t just a recommendation; it’s a non-negotiable requirement. Ignoring these steps can lead to serious injury, fire, or gas leaks.

Here are the critical safety precautions, forming the foundation of any successful how to change wire in gas stove tips:

  • Disconnect All Power: Locate your home’s main electrical panel (breaker box) and switch off the circuit breaker that supplies power to your kitchen or, specifically, your stove. If unsure, turn off the main breaker to the entire house. Verify power is off by trying to turn on another kitchen appliance.
  • Shut Off the Gas Supply: Find the main gas shut-off valve for your stove. It’s usually a yellow or red handle located behind the stove where the gas line connects. Turn the handle perpendicular to the gas pipe to shut off the flow. If you can’t find it or are unsure, shut off the main gas supply to your house.
  • Ensure Ventilation: If you suspect a gas leak or are working in a confined space, ensure adequate ventilation. Open windows and doors.
  • Wear Personal Protective Equipment (PPE): Safety glasses will protect your eyes from dust or debris. Work gloves can protect your hands from sharp edges inside the stove.
  • Work in a Well-Lit Area: A good flashlight or headlamp is essential for seeing connections clearly in tight spaces.

Never bypass these safety steps. Your well-being is far more important than any repair job.

Gathering Your Tools and Materials

Having the right tools on hand makes any DIY project smoother and safer. Before you even think about touching your stove, gather everything you’ll need.

Essential Tools:

  • Screwdriver Set: You’ll likely need Phillips and flathead screwdrivers, possibly a nut driver set for various panel screws.
  • Wire Strippers: For cleanly removing insulation from wires without damaging the copper strands.
  • Needle-Nose Pliers: Great for gripping small wires, bending terminals, or reaching into tight spots.
  • Multimeter: An essential tool for testing continuity and ensuring wires are dead before handling. This is crucial for verifying power is off and diagnosing wire integrity.
  • Flashlight or Headlamp: For illuminating dark crevices inside the stove.
  • Camera or Smartphone: To take detailed photos of wiring connections before disconnecting anything. This is a game-changer for reassembly.
  • Gloves: To protect your hands.

Materials You Might Need:

  • Replacement Wire: This is critical. Ensure the new wire is the correct gauge (thickness) and type (e.g., high-temperature insulated wire if it’s near a burner) for your stove model. Check your stove’s service manual or consult a parts supplier.
  • Electrical Connectors/Terminals: If the old wire uses specific crimp connectors, ensure you have matching ones for the new wire.
  • Heat Shrink Tubing or Electrical Tape: For insulating new connections properly. Heat shrink provides a more robust and professional finish.
  • Zip Ties or Wire Clips: To secure new wiring along its original path, preventing it from touching hot surfaces or moving parts.

Step-by-Step Guide: How to Change Wire in Gas Stove

This is where the rubber meets the road. Follow these steps carefully to successfully replace a faulty wire in your gas stove.

Disconnecting the Power and Gas Supply

This step cannot be overstated. Double-check that both the electrical power and the gas supply to your stove are completely shut off. Use your multimeter to confirm no voltage is present at the stove’s outlet if accessible, or test an adjacent outlet to confirm the breaker is off.

Accessing the Wiring Compartment

The location of your stove’s wiring will vary by model. You’ll typically need to remove some combination of the following:

  • Burner Grates and Burner Caps: Lift these off.
  • Burner Bases: These might be held by screws or simply lift out. Be gentle with igniter electrodes.
  • Control Knobs: Pull them straight off.
  • Control Panel/Back Panel: This is often where the main wiring harness and igniter module are located. Look for screws around the perimeter.
  • Stove Top: Some stove tops lift up or are hinged, providing access underneath.

Take your time. Don’t force anything. Keep track of all screws and components, perhaps placing them in a logical order or labeled containers.

Identifying and Documenting the Wires

This is perhaps the most critical part of the entire process. Before you disconnect anything, take multiple clear photos with your smartphone from different angles.

  • Document where each wire connects.
  • Note wire colors and any labels.
  • Pay attention to routing and how wires are secured.

If you suspect a specific wire is faulty, visually inspect it for signs of burning, fraying, or breaks. You can also use your multimeter to perform a continuity test. With power off, touch the probes to each end of the suspected wire. A good wire will show continuity (a beep or a low resistance reading). A broken wire will show no continuity (open circuit).

Removing the Old Wire

Once you’ve identified the faulty wire and documented its connections:

  • Carefully disconnect the wire from its terminals. This might involve unscrewing a terminal, gently prying off a push-on connector, or snipping a crimped connection.
  • Note the length and routing of the old wire.

Installing the New Wire

Now, it’s time to put your new wire in place:

  • Prepare the New Wire: If necessary, cut the new wire to the same length as the old one. Use your wire strippers to expose the correct amount of copper at each end, matching the old wire’s preparation.
  • Attach Connectors: If using new terminals, crimp them securely onto the stripped ends of the new wire. Give a gentle tug to ensure they are firm.
  • Connect the Wire: Following your photos and documentation, connect the new wire to its proper terminals. Ensure connections are tight and secure.
  • Insulate Connections: If you crimped new terminals, apply heat shrink tubing and shrink it with a heat gun, or wrap the connections securely with high-quality electrical tape.
  • Route and Secure: Route the new wire exactly as the old one was, using zip ties or clips to keep it away from hot surfaces, sharp edges, and moving parts. This is vital for long-term safety and functionality.

Reassembling and Testing

With the new wire installed, it’s time to put everything back together and test your work.

  • Reassemble the Stove: Reverse the steps you took to access the wiring. Ensure all panels, burners, and grates are reinstalled correctly and securely.
  • Reconnect Gas Supply: Slowly turn the gas shut-off valve back on.
  • Perform a Leak Test: Mix a solution of dish soap and water. Apply it liberally to all gas connections you may have disturbed (even if you didn’t directly touch them, movement can cause issues). Watch for bubbles, which indicate a gas leak. If you see bubbles, tighten the connection slightly and re-test. If bubbles persist, shut off the gas immediately and call a professional.
  • Reconnect Power: Go back to your breaker box and flip the circuit breaker for your kitchen or stove back on.
  • Test Functionality: Turn on each burner individually and ensure the igniter sparks and the burner lights quickly and consistently. Check that the flame is strong and even.

Troubleshooting Common Wiring Issues After Replacement

Sometimes, even after carefully following all the steps, things don’t quite work perfectly. Don’t get discouraged; troubleshooting is part of the DIY process.

If your stove still isn’t working, or a specific burner igniter isn’t sparking, here are some common problems and solutions:

  • Loose Connections: Re-check every connection point for the new wire and any others you might have disturbed. A loose connection is the most frequent culprit.
  • Incorrect Wiring: Double-check your photos and ensure the new wire is connected to the exact terminals the old one was. It’s easy to mix up similar-looking terminals.
  • Damaged Insulation: While routing the new wire, did it get pinched or scraped? This could create a new short. Inspect the entire length of the new wire.
  • Another Component Failure: The wire might have been only one part of the problem. If the igniter itself is old or faulty, or if the igniter module (spark module) has failed, replacing the wire won’t fix it. Use your multimeter to test the igniter’s resistance or continuity, if your stove’s manual provides specifications.
  • Gas Supply Issue: Did you fully open the gas valve? Is there any air in the gas line after reconnection? Try lighting all burners for a short period to purge any air.

If you’ve re-checked everything and are still stumped, it might be time to consult a professional appliance technician.

When to Call a Professional

While many DIY projects are empowering, knowing your limits is crucial, especially when dealing with gas and electricity. Don’t hesitate to call a professional if:

  • You’re Uncomfortable or Unsure: If at any point you feel out of your depth or uncertain about a step, stop and call a qualified appliance technician or a licensed gas fitter.
  • You Detect a Gas Leak: If the soap-and-water test shows persistent bubbling or you smell gas, shut off the gas immediately and call your gas company or a professional. Do not try to fix a gas leak yourself.
  • Complex Electrical Issues: If troubleshooting points to a faulty control board, igniter module, or other complex electrical components beyond a simple wire, a professional will have the specialized tools and expertise to diagnose and repair it safely.
  • Warranty Concerns: If your stove is still under warranty, performing DIY repairs might void it. Check your warranty terms before proceeding.

There’s no shame in calling a pro. Safety should always be your top priority.

Frequently Asked Questions About Gas Stove Wiring

How do I know which wire needs changing?

Often, a faulty wire will show visible signs of damage like charring, frayed insulation, or breaks, especially if it’s near a heat source. If not visible, use a multimeter to perform a continuity test on wires connected to the non-functioning component (e.g., an igniter). A wire with no continuity is likely broken.

Can I use any electrical wire for my gas stove?

No, you cannot. You must use a replacement wire of the correct gauge (thickness) and type, especially if it’s a high-temperature wire designed for use near burners. Using an incorrect wire can be a fire hazard. Always consult your stove’s service manual or an appliance parts supplier for the correct specifications.

Is it safe to change stove wiring myself?

It can be safe if you strictly follow all safety precautions, especially disconnecting both power and gas. However, it requires attention to detail and a basic understanding of electrical work. If you are uncomfortable at any point, or if you detect a gas leak, it is safer to call a qualified professional.

How long does changing a gas stove wire take?

For an experienced DIYer, changing a single wire might take 1-2 hours, including safety checks, disassembly, repair, and reassembly. For a beginner, it could take 2-4 hours or more, as you’ll be proceeding more cautiously and learning as you go. Preparation time for gathering tools and materials should also be factored in.
